With its dizzying elevation extreme of a mere 1, 190 feet, pancake-flat Iowa's main outdoor attractions are of the horizontal persuasion. Two national scenic byways thread the state, while any number of country roads will take you through a land of farms, covered bridges, and quiet towns. Fishing and hunting are both popular in the state, with the Missouri and Mississippi rivers both offering the chance to cast for trout, catfish, walleye, and and bass. Common game species to be found on hunting land for sale in Iowa include whitetail deer, turkey, pheasant, ducks, quail, grouse, geese and dove. Fish species include walleye, pike, bass and catfish.
